URL:https://www.arnoldmagnetics.com/event/lift-webinar-march-2024/ ATTACH;FMTTYPE=: END:VEVENT BEGIN:VEVENT DTSTART;TZID=America/New_York:20230608T100000 DTEND;TZID=America/New_York:20230608T110000 DTSTAMP:20251125T214047 CREATED:20230501T180606Z LAST-MODIFIED:20230501T180606Z UID:11099-1686218400-1686222000@www.arnoldmagnetics.com SUMMARY:Webinar: Understanding Commercial and Military Compliance for Permanent Magnet Products DESCRIPTION:Navigating government compliance when it comes to rare earth elements for permanent magnets can be confusing. Besides the usual requirements for ITAR and DFARS\, there are additional regulations from the National Defense Authorization Act (NDAA)/John McCain Act\, as well as licensing pitfalls to avoid. In this webinar\, we’ll review terms\, explain the various regulations and help you learn where to find regulation and legislation\, points data should be protected\, and properly vet suppliers to ensure your relationship with your aerospace\, defense and government customers is protected. \n\nHelp protect your company from serious violations and loss of business.\nExplore some of the differences between general import/export regulations and those specific to aerospace and defense use.\nBecome familiar with additional regulations pertaining to rare earth elements and other specialty metals.\nGain a deeper understanding of NDAA legislation.\n\nThe presentation will wrap up with a short Q&A as time permits. \nSpeaker: Aaron Williams\, VP Sales & Marketing \nWilliams has 15 years of engineering and R&D experience in the magnetics industry\, and is an active participant in industry collaborations including motor and motion\, magnetics\, MCMA\, ECCE and IEEE/IEMDC. Watch the on-demand Tech Talk using the link below. \n  \n\n\nWatch On-Demand URL:https://www.arnoldmagnetics.com/event/thin-metals-in-battery-technology-tech-talk-2/ END:VEVENT BEGIN:VEVENT DTSTART;VALUE=DATE:20220215 DTEND;VALUE=DATE:20220216 DTSTAMP:20251125T214047 CREATED:20220121T181246Z LAST-MODIFIED:20220208T002306Z UID:9104-1644883200-1644969599@www.arnoldmagnetics.com SUMMARY:TECH TALK: ELECTROMAGNETIC SOLENOID MANUFACTURING OPTIMIZATION DESCRIPTION:Many high-end technologies require the use of electron beams for their end use. These items include radar components\, oncology equipment\, satellite communications\, and linear accelerators. Depending on the beam focusing requirements\, these solenoids can range in size from fitting in the palm of your hand to being taller than a person.
